"The Society for Effective Lessons Learned Sharing is a volunteer organization comprised of members from various DOE [Department of Energy] programs, Operations Offices, sites, and contractors that share the common goal of improving information exchange across the DOE complex, as well as between the Department and other public and private organizations."
If you're interested in the subject of lessons learned, this site might be for you. There's some potentially interesting things under the Fact Sheets and Meeting Proceedings. For me, its use of pdf files for everything, even the one-page fact sheets, is annoying. (I find that many Government-related sites overuse pdfs where simple html web pages would suffice.)
